Abstract:
The significance of breast cancer lymph node micrometastasis has been addressed by numerous studies. Although the results of these studies are mixed, most of the larger trials strongly suggest that the presence of a lymph node micrometastasis, in the absence of other nodal disease, will have a negative impact on disease free survival and on overall survival. The focus of this article is to analyze the biologic and therapeutic significance of micrometastatic disease in the axillary lymph nodes of patients with breast cancer.
